Abstract

Aflatoxins (AFTs) are a group of closely related toxins that are produced by different fungus species. Food and feed contamination with AFT is a worldwide health-related problem. AFB1 is considered to possess the highest toxicity among various types of secondary metabolites produced by a larger number of Aspergillus spp, and classified as a group I carcinogen for humans by the International Agency for Research on Cancer. Since black tea possesses strong antioxidant activity, it protects cells and tissues against oxidative stress. Curcumin (CMN), a naturally occurring agent, has a combination of biological and pharmacological properties that include antioxidant activity.
